Samsung Galaxy A50, A30, A10 launched at aggressive prices
Samsung’s recently revealed 2019 Galaxy A series of phones have been launched in India at prices so competitive that the Chinese competition will be forced to take note.
Galaxy A50
- Starting at Rs 19,990 for the 4GB/ 64GB variant and going up to Rs 22,990 for the 6GB/ 64GB variant, the Galaxy A50 is the cheapest Samsung phone ever to come with an in-display fingerprint sensor (optical type).
- Then, it has a 6.4-inch Infinity-U Super AMOLED display of FHD+ resolution, an Exynos 9610 SoC, 25MP front camera and a 4,000mAh battery with fast charging.
- The A50 also boasts a triple rear camera setup. The main sensor here is a 25 MP f/1.7 unit that’s accompanied by a 5 MP f/2.2 depth sensor and a third 8MP ultra wide-angle lens.
Galaxy A30
- The Samsung Galaxy A30 is priced at Rs 16,990 for the sole 4GB/ 64GB variant.
- Its display and battery are the same as the A50, but it’s powered by the less powerful Exynos 7885 SoC.
- Then, the Galaxy A30 also has different cameras – the main sensor here is a 16MP f/1.7 unit that’s accompanied by a 5MP f/2.2 depth sensor. There’s no wide-angle shooter on this one. The front camera is of 16MP resolution.
- Finally, this phone doesn’t have the under-display fingerprint sensor either – it instead opts for the traditional rear-mounted unit.
Galaxy A10
- The entry-level Galaxy A10 is powered by an Exynos 7884 SoC along with just 2GB of RAM. There’s no fingerprint scanner on this phone.
- The A10 also uses a single 13MP f/1.9 rear camera and a 5MP f/2.0 front camera.
- The screen here is a 6.2-inch Infinity-V panel of HD+ resolution. Everything on this device is backed by a 3,400mAh battery.
- The Samsung Galaxy A10 costs Rs 8,490.
